O ovoj e-knjizi

Marine to Politics explores J.D. Vance's journey from a Marine shaped by the Rust Belt to a political figure, examining his calculated navigation through Yale Law School and into American politics. The book highlights how Vance's socio-economic background and military service informed his political ambition and strategy. It argues that Vance's rise isn't accidental but a strategic leveraging of his understanding of working-class anxieties and the political climate. The book uniquely analyzes Vance's career through the lens of political maneuvering and strategic decision-making, offering a balanced perspective on his evolution and the rise of conservatism. For instance, his military background provided a foundation for his later political positions. The book progresses by examining Vance's early life, his time at Yale, his career transitions, and finally, his political platform, drawing conclusions about American conservatism.
